# CatalogPrime — Environments

CatalogPrime runs in three environments: dev, staging, prod. Cache invalidation for the product catalog is event-driven in prod and TTL-based elsewhere. Invalidation messages are signed; staging skips signature checks, which is a known gap under review. Purge fan-out touches the edge tier only; origin caches expire on schedule. No cross-environment invalidation is permitted. Secrets rotate quarterly. For audit purposes, the effective configuration per environment is recorded below.

deployment values, yahag-tawef:
ZORWYN_HOST=zorwyn.tolvaqlabs.internal
ZORWYN_PORT=9300

Onboarding: Harvestlink Telemetry Gateway

The Harvestlink gateway ingests sensor data from tractors and combines, normalizes units, and writes batches to the fleet store every 30 seconds. Support staff should check the ingest lag dashboard before escalating. Dropped packets are retried for one hour. For read-only diagnostics against the fleet store, use the connection string below.

replica DSN, fadup-yagug: mssql://rusox_svc:0K2wrVJefbkR2n@db-53b3.qirvangrid.example:5432/istix

Ticket: PRICE-EXP staging env misconfigured (Gantrey Tickets)

The fare-bucket experiment on Gantrey staging is reading prod flag values. Root cause: env file copied from the prod template during Friday's rebuild. Fix in review: point EXPERIMENT_SOURCE back to the staging flag service and clear the cached assignments. Reviewer note: the staging flag service also requires its own auth token, so the corrected env file adds the following line.

sealed setting: RELAY_SECRET5=82864